Goldenrod Park
Description
Goldenrod Park has two playgrounds near each other, though one definitely is a lot older than the other space. Neither play area is large. There’s a street separating the two areas but it’s closed off on one end so traffic is unlikely.
The most unique thing at this park is a tree house-type play area that kids can climb up into. There are look-out view-finders and a pole to slide down. It’s near the newer playground, which also has a climbing wall and swing set that includes an adaptive swing. The newer playground is covered with mulch.
The older area has a swing set, diggers and a worn down tunnel slide. It’s a sandy playground.
Overall, it’s a spread out park with small play areas with few pieces of equipment. There isn’t much for seating for adults watching kids, except a picnic table.
